Bayonne, vainqueur de Lyon, plane vers les phases finales

L'arrière de Bayonne Cheikh Tiberghien marque le quatrième essai de son équipe lors du match de Top 14 entre l'Aviron Bayonnais et le Lyon Olympique Universitaire Rugby au Stade Jean-Dauger à Bayonne, le 29 mars 2025. (Photo by Gaizka IROZ / AFP) (Photo by GAIZKA IROZ/AFP via Getty Images)

L’Aviron Bayonnais a écarté le LOU, concurrent direct dans la course à la qualification pour les phases finales du Top 14 (28-14), et conforte sa 4e place.

La route est encore longue, mais le tracé de Bayonne vers les phases finale de Top 14, ce qui serait une première, se dégage de plus en plus. À Jean-Dauger, les Bayonnais, quatrièmes au classement, ont battu Lyon, cinquième au coup d’envoi, avec le bonus offensif (28-14).

Pas menés une seule seconde au score, les Basques ont une fois de plus fait étalage de leur solidité à domicile. Ils sont en effet les seuls, avec Toulon, à avoir remporté toutes leurs rencontres à domicile cette saison.

Ils ont construit ce nouveau succès méthodiquement. Deux essais (Rouet 9e, Tatafu 27e) et deux pénalités de Joris Segonds (25e, 40e) pour distancer l’adversaire en première période. Puis la quête du bonus offensif après la pause, avec deux nouveaux essais en quatre minutes peu avant l’heure de jeu (Erbinartegaray 53e, Tiberghien 57e).

Le LOU, qui restait sur une dynamique très positive qui lui a permis de grimper à la 5e place, juste derrière Bayonne, a eu du mal à exister. En manque de réalisme, les joueurs de Karim Ghezal ont dû attendre la 65e minute pour atteindre enfin l’en-but bayonnais.

Le déplacement est particulièrement mauvais pour les Lyonnais, qui ont aussi perdu sur civière leur feu follet géorgien Darrit Niniashvili après un choc en l’air avec Artur Iturria.
